104 Avenue Albert 1er sits in Rueil-Malmaison, a vibrant business district just 12km from the heart of Paris, home to startups, entrepreneurs and leading French company headquarters. The Rueil-Malmaison railway station is around a 3-minute walk with links to the Paris suburban network, the Danielle Casanova bus stop is nearby, and major roadways connect the surrounding area. On-site parking and several public lots make driving in easy. The Chateau de Malmaison, once the residence of Napoleon and Josephine, is a short distance away as a national heritage site, while the Parc de Bois-Preau offers a serene escape for breaks or informal meetings just moments from the office.
